This study evaluated the influence of administering different levels of L-arginine into the eggs of 0-day-old Japanese quail embryos. On day 0 of incubation, 480 eggs (120 for each treatment group) were injected with 0% arginine (C group), 1% arginine (T1), 2% arginine (T2), or 3% arginine (T3). After hatching, 336 quail chicks (84 chicks produced from each ovo injection treatment) were placed in an experimental quail house and allocated to four treatment groups of three replicates, with 16 quail chicks for each replicate. Traits involved in this study were hatchability rate, initial body weight (7 days of age), final body weight (42 days old), feed intake, weight gain, feed conversion ratio, blood serum glucose, protein, cholesterol, total lipids, triglycerides, calcium, and phosphorus concentrations, and proportional weights of the carcass, breast, legs, backbone, wings, neck, abdominal fat, liver, heart, and gizzard. Results revealed that in ovo injection with different levels of L-arginine on day 0 of incubation, there were significant increases in the hatchability rate, initial body weight, final body weight, feed conversion ratio, blood serum glucose, protein, total protein, calcium, and phosphorus concentrations, as well as the proportional weights of the carcass, breast, legs, liver, heart, and gizzard. However, there was no significant difference in feed intake between treatment groups. Significant decreases were recorded in blood serum cholesterol, total lipid and triglyceride concentrations, and proportional weights of the backbone, wings, and abdominal fat. In conclusion, the inoculation of different levels of L-arginine into the eggs of 0-day-old quail embryos, especially at levels of 2% and 3% arginine, resulted in a significant improvement in the productive and physiological performance of the quail. Hence, ovo injection with L-arginine could be used as a tool for enhancing the hatchability rate and productive performance of quail hatched from the egg.

... Show MoreOrthodontic treatment is an inclusive treatment that includes growth adjustment of the craniofacial area and alveolar bone reconstruction that affects the movement of teeth. Apply orthodontic forces to correct teeth anomaly via alveolar bone remodeling includes a combination of cellular and molecular events in the gum. Orthodontic tooth movement is based on force induced periodontal ligament and alveolar bone remodeling. Mechanical motivation on a tooth causes an inflamed response in the gum tissue. Inflammatory immune markers stimulate the biological processes associated with alveolar bone resorption. The aim of this article is shedding light on the significance role inflammatory immune response in orthodontic treatment.
